Replanting with native plants

Replanting with native plants have many positives for the surrounding environment.

Replanting areas once you have removed invasive plants will help to:

  • stop erosion
  • stop invasive plants from re-growing due to reduced space, nutrients and sunlight available
  • create canopy cover
  • attract native wildlife to your garden
  • create cooler micro-climates on your property.
